Transaction f7dd7de569a9215f0df6420d6c11e85a870bc63613220399df6fa84c092153b6

60 Input
1 Outputs
  • f7dd7de569a9215f0df6420d6c11e85a870bc63613220399df6fa84c092153b6:0
  • value  53352908
    address  bc1qm34lsc65zpw79lxes69zkqmk6ee3ewf0j77s3h